11:15 GMT: The players are at the Emirates

The players have arrived at the Emirates for this first Premier League game of 2022. In just over an hour, the ball will be rolling once again in England's top flight.

10:45 GMT: It'll be Stuart Attwell in the middle

Stuart Attwell is the referee for this Arsenal vs Manchester City game at the Emirates. He has whistled each of these sides once already this season, doing so for Arsenal's 2-0 win over Newcastle and City's 3-0 win over Everton, both in November.

10:15 GMT: No Arteta for the visit of Manchester City

Mikel Arteta won't be able to go up against his former colleague Guardiola, with the Arsenal manager having tested positive for COVID-19. He'll have to watch this one from home.

10:00 GMT: Manchester City are eight points clear

Coming into this Premier League match, Manchester City sit top of the table and they hold an eight-point advantage over second-placed Chelsea. Liverpool have a game in hand that could reduce the gap to six points, but Pep Guardiola's side are looking comfortable at the too.

09:40 GMT: What are the Arsenal and Manchester City predicted line-ups?

Mikel Arteta can't be at this game because of COVID-19, but his line-up is expected to be: Aaron Ramsdale; Ben White, Rob Holding, Gabriel Magalhaes, Kieran Tierney; Granit Xhaka, Thomas Partey; Bukayo Saka, Martin Odegaard, Emile Smith Rowe; Alexandre Lacazette. As for Manchester City, they're expected to start as: Ederson; Joao Cancelo, Ruben Dias, Aymeric Laporte, Nathan Ake; Bernardo Silva, Ilkay Gundogan, Kevin De Bruyne; Riyad Mahrez, Phil Foden, Raheem Sterling.
